Planned Parenthood Files Class Action Against South Carolina DHHS Chief
Last Updated on August 8, 2018
Planned Parenthood South Atlantic v. Edwards et al
Filed: July 27, 2018 ◆§ 2:18cv2078
South Carolina DHHS director Joshua Baker has been sued over the agency's decision to terminate Planned Parenthood South Atlantic’s status as a qualified Medicaid provider.
Planned Parenthood South Atlantic and an individual plaintiff have filed a proposed class action against South Carolina Department of Health and Human Services Director Joshua Baker in his official capacity. The lawsuit stems from the agency’s and South Carolina Governor Henry McMaster’s allegedly “unlawful and politically motivated” decision to terminate Planned Parenthood South Atlantic’s status as a qualified Medicaid provider, a move the complaint alleges was made “solely on the basis that PPSAT provides safe, legal abortion outside the Medicaid program.”
